Sharjah Civil Defence Boosts Fire Safety Inspections
The Sharjah Civil Defence Authority is taking significant steps to bolster fire safety across the emirate. By intensifying inspection campaigns in industrial, commercial, and residential areas, the Authority aims to ensure compliance with safety regulations and minimize the risk of fire-related incidents.
Focus of Inspection Campaigns
Inspection teams are actively conducting both scheduled and surprise visits to various facilities, including warehouses, maintenance workshops, and commercial storage sites. These inspections primarily assess the effectiveness of fire prevention and alarm systems, electrical safety measures, and the proper storage of flammable materials.
Educational Component
Beyond identifying violations, the campaign also emphasizes education. Inspectors are engaging with workers to promote best safety practices, fostering a culture of prevention in workplaces. Brigadier Yousef Obaid Bin Harmoul Al Shamsi, Director General of the Sharjah Civil Defence Authority, highlighted the importance of community involvement in safety efforts. “Safety requires awareness and active participation from everyone—workers, business owners, and the wider community,” he stated.

Technological Integration
Sharjah Civil Defence is also leveraging advanced technologies to improve inspection processes. These innovations facilitate quicker and more accurate risk assessments, allowing teams to devise immediate improvement plans for high-priority sites. This technological integration is crucial for maintaining high safety standards.
Training and Community Engagement
In addition to inspections, the Authority is committed to training its personnel to meet international safety standards. Regular awareness programs and workshops are conducted to engage various community groups, promoting a culture of safety and readiness throughout Sharjah. Brigadier Al Shamsi emphasized that these efforts contribute to a safe and sustainable environment, which is vital for local economic growth and investment.
